QR scanning

Use scanning workflows to reduce manual entry, improve speed, and increase inventory accuracy throughout warehouse operations.

How it works

Step 1: Navigate to QR Templates under Administration

Go to the QR Templates page located under the Administration section in the main navigation menu.
On this page, you can manage all your templates for inventory items, invoices, and storage bins.

Step 2: Manage Existing QR Templates

On the QR Templates page, easily manage your existing layout configurations:

  • Click Preview to view a quick preview of any template.
  • Click Edit to open and modify an existing template layout.
  • Click the 3 dots menu (more options icon) next to any template to Delete it or set it as your Default template.

Step 3: Add a New Custom QR Template

To create a customized template, click the Add Template button at the top of the page.
This will open the template builder interface where you can configure custom dimensions, layout elements, and sample data.

Step 4: Configure Layout Settings

In the builder, start by defining the core layout settings for your QR code label:

  • Target Entity: Select the entity type for this template (Inventory Item, Storage Bin, or Invoice).
  • Measurement Unit: Choose your preferred unit of measurement (mm, cm, in, or px).
  • Dimensions: Specify the target label Height and Width.
  • Base Background Color: Set the base background color for the QR label layout.

Step 5: Edit Sample Data for Live Preview

Click the Edit Sample Data button to open the preview sample data popup.
In this popup, customize sample text and data values to see how dynamic fields will appear directly on your layout preview. Click Done Editing to save the customized values and return to the canvas.

Step 6: Add & Position Dynamic Elements

In the Elements section, click on any element you want to place on your template:

  • Move & Resize: Drag elements directly on the template canvas preview to adjust their positions, or drag their boundary handles to resize them.
  • Configure Element Properties: Select an added element to open its Element Properties panel and customize details including:
    • Content: Pick dynamic placeholder content from the available list (such as Inventory Title, UPC Code, Storage Path, etc.) to display in that element.
    • Position: Fine-tune precise X & Y coordinate positions.
    • Typography: Adjust Font Size and Font Weight.
    • Alignment: Set Horizontal and Vertical text alignments.
    • Colors: Customize Text Color and Background Color.
  • Delete Element: Click the Delete Element button if you wish to remove a selected element from the canvas.

Step 7: Configure Page Preview & Sheet Settings

Switch to the Page Preview tab to see how multiple QR code labels render on a printed page layout:

  • Customise sheet Page Dimensions.
  • Adjust Page Margins.
  • Set Label Gap spacing between printed labels.

Step 8: Save the Customized QR Template

Enter a descriptive Template Name in the designated field and click the Save Template button to persist your new QR layout.


Step 9: Utilize Templates for QR Scanning Workflows

Once created and saved, these custom QR templates can be printed and scanned across various operational workflows:

  • Scan & Assign Storage Location: Rapidly assign inventory items to designated warehouse bins by scanning item and storage QR codes.
  • Packaging Verification: Perform instant QR code scans during order packing jobs to verify items and update packaging statuses.
  • Retrieve Inventory Details: Scan QR labels on items or bins to instantly pull up complete item details, specs, and status context.
